Thousands Rally in Nationwide Protests

 


Thousands of demonstrators took to the streets on Saturday for the annual March for Our Lives rally, a nationwide protest against gun violence.


The non-profit group, founded by survivors of the 2018 Parkland shooting, told NBC News there were about 450 rallies planned across the United States, including in cities like Chicago; Los Angeles; NYC; Detroit; and Washington, D.C. The demonstrations come amid renewed calls for tighter gun control measures, as the nation continues reeling from a series of mass shootings.

Did Instagram Addiction Result in Eating Disorder

 


A California family is suing Meta, claiming Instagram is to blame for their teenage daughter’s eating disorder and mental health issues.


NBC News reports the lawsuit was filed Monday in the U.S. District Court for the Northern District of California, by Kathleen and Jeffrey Spence on behalf of their daughter Alexis Spence. The lawsuit alleges Alexis, who began using Instagram at age 11, suffered from “anxiety, depression, self-harm, eating disorders, and, ultimately, suicidal ideation” after becoming addicted to the social media platform.

Two Employees Rescued From Chocolate Factory

 


A Lancaster County 911 spokesperson told TODAY that a call was received around 10:51 a.m. about the incident. “The incident currently is being downgraded, but originally two employees were stuck in a sort of dry chocolate,” the spokesperson said. The Elizabethtown Fire Department later transported the two workers to a nearby hospital as a likely precautionary measure.

Jennifer Lopez Joins Latina Entrepreneurs

 


Jennifer Lopez's new partnership is providing Latina entrepreneurs with a $14 billion infusion in loan capital by 2030.


Lopez is teaming up with Grameen America, a New York City-based microfinance organization, to expand access to capital with the goal of reaching 600,000 Latina entrepreneurs, while also investing six million hours into financial education training for these women as well.
